Weatherford, INT Expand Collaboration to Create 2D, 3D Real-Time Well Visualization

INT’s IVAAP framework provides next-level real-time well visualization in 2D and 3D for Weatherford’s Centro digital well delivery software.

HOUSTON, TX – August 18, 2020 – Weatherford International plc announced a strengthened collaboration with upstream data visualization provider INT to provide next-level, real-time well visualization in both 2D and 3D. Weatherford will embed INT’s IVAAP framework into the Weatherford Centro™ digital well delivery software, advancing its data visualization capabilities.


“Weatherford’s selection of the IVAAP framework for their Centro software is extremely exciting for INT,” said Dr. Olivier Lhemann, President of INT, Inc. “Centro is leading the industry-wide digital transformation as part of a new generation of applications built fully in HTML5. It is both highly collaborative and powerful, but still very user-friendly. INT has worked with Weatherford for many years and we are proud to be part of their innovative approach to integrating data and analytics within a single platform.”


Weatherford Centro digital well delivery software offers exceptional workflows that seamlessly integrate every element of an operator’s well data, allowing team members from any global location to access, share, and store all vital project information at any time. Combining Centro’s advanced data visualization capabilities with the IVAAP framework provides next-level real-time well visualization in 2D and 3D.


“Weatherford provides digital solutions that help our customers reduce costs and increase operational efficiency,” said Gustavo Urdaneta, Drilling Software Global Manager at Weatherford. “The proven E&P data visualization and open architecture design was a critical factor in selecting the IVAAP framework to enhance the value of user centric visualizations in our well delivery software.”


Weatherford has been at the forefront of software innovation, especially in drilling and production. Both companies have built a strong relationship by embedding advanced HTML5 domain visualizations libraries and modules from INT in several Weatherford software applications.

Picking Horizons in INTViewer 5.2

Horizon picking is a feature that INTViewer has included from the start. However, after discussing with several long-time users, I have found that the evolutions brought by each release can be missed. The release of INTViewer 5.2 is a good opportunity to tour basic picking options.

First, a bit of terminology. The term “horizon” in geoscience is often a generic term for surfaces. In INTViewer, “horizon” is a surface that is typically defined by trace number or INLINE-XLINE as opposed to X-Y.

In INTViewer’s lingo, surfaces defined in X-Y are “grid surfaces” if they follow an X-Y grid. If they don’t follow of well-defined grid, they are “Gocad” or “Triangle Mesh” surfaces. The “grid” of an “horizon” is the grid of the underlying seismic dataset. Users can work with horizons on 2D datasets, 3D volumes, and gathers.

When it comes to editing horizons, there are three picking modes available: Mouse Drag, Mouse Click, and AutoTrack.

The Mouse Drag picking mode is the default and lets you draw continuous lines across a XSection.

Mouse Click is a faster picking mode as you only need to pick a few points. After you release the mouse, the traces between the last two points are auto-picked.

AutoTrack is the fastest picking mode as it will pick across the entire section visualized on screen.

Users are not limited to one picking mode. Keyboard shortcuts let you switch modes interactively as you are picking points. You can elect to “snap” picks to peaks or troughs and sample measurements are affected by default by any trace processor that might be applied.

Your picks are reflected in real time in all windows, including 3D windows.

Which brings me to this new INTViewer feature. Picking in 2D is a tedious activity. A faster way to pick a full volume is to use the built-in horizon interpolation.

This interpolation uses the Natural Neighbor algorithm to propagate existing picks into a full surface. This is an option accessible from the contextual menu of an horizon layer.

The horizon extraction is also accessible from the contextual menu of an horizon layer. This is a tool with numerous options, useful for 4D analysis. As this is an operation that is typically applied to multiple datasets, it is scriptable in Python. INTViewer will create Python scripts for you based upon your extraction parameters.

There are a few features not included in this tour: A calculator is available to combine the attribute of several horizons with a mathematical formula. Formulas can also be applied to trace headers to create header horizons.
